Ferrari's Binotto: 'Not the time for selfishness and tactics'

Ferrari's Mattia Binotto says the Italian outfit will consider the interests of F1 as a whole when it voices its opinion on whether the sport should postpone next year's regulation overhaul. The coronavirus crisis has severely disrupted F1's calendar, with the opening three months of the season literally wiped out by cancellations and postponements. The potential loss of revenue for F1 and for its teams could wreak havoc on the finances of the midfield teams in a season when everyone is set to run double developments programs associated with the current campaign - once it gets underway - but also with next year's big rule changes.
